39. A member who is in a situation of conflict of interest must immediately notify the chair or co-chairs of the board of directors. In the case of the chair or co-chairs, they must immediately notify the board of their situation of conflict of interest.
The member must abstain from discussing and voting on any issue involving the interest declared or concerning directly the contracting party that appointed the member or the entity that the member represents. The member must also withdraw from the meeting for the duration of the discussion and the vote on the issue.
This section does not prevent a member from expressing himself or herself on general application measures.
O.C. 1535-2022, s. 39.
